Immunoassays are according to the basic principle that a particular antigen will promote a really particular (one of a kind) immune response, and proteins (identified as antibodies) made as a result of an immune response may be used to detect the existence of the goal compound inside of a sample. Immunoassays are quickly and precise tests employed to check Organic techniques by monitoring unique proteins and antibodies. Immunoassays depend on the power of an antibody to bind to a certain molecular construction and can be used to detect certain molecules get more info during the laboratory. Labeled Immunoassay one. Radioimmunoassay(RIA) RIA is most likely the oldest variety of immunoassay. The radioactive isotope is utilized to label the antibody/antigen. The amount of radioactive alerts is inversely proportional to that of concentrate on antigens. two. Counting immunoassay (CIA) In CIA, polystyrene beads are coated with a number of antibodies which might be complementary to your concentrate on antigens. Throughout incubation, the beads bind to many different antigens and jointly sort a considerable mass, but some beads are not certain. The whole Remedy passes by way of a cell counter, with only unbound beads counted. The level of unbound beads is inversely proportional to that of antigens. three. Enzyme immunoassays (EIA) or enzyme-connected immunosorbent assays (ELISA) While in the ELISA, the antibody is associated with an enzyme. Just after incubation with the antigen, the unbound antibody is eluted. The sure antibody-enzyme connected to the goal antigen is noticed by incorporating substrates to the solution. The enzyme catalyzes the chemical reactions from the substrate to produce quantifiable coloration improvements. 4. Fluorescence immunoassay (FIA) In FIA, antibodies are labeled with fluorescent probes. Following incubation Along with the antigen, the antibody-antigen complex is isolated and the fluorescence depth is measured. five. Chemiluminescence immunoassay (CLIA) CLIA is the same as ELISA or fluorescent immunoassay, but its reporter gene differs.
